Transaction 2450a59ecbd70cc83bae96e39c7759b950653007591641fe407383cef29a3399

23 Input
2 Outputs
  • 2450a59ecbd70cc83bae96e39c7759b950653007591641fe407383cef29a3399:0
  • value  311813
    address  35qqFsGE7u15SGkTbxfrhsxmBXsYo8UJkf
  • 2450a59ecbd70cc83bae96e39c7759b950653007591641fe407383cef29a3399:1
  • value  39930467
    address  1AanKeytDFRhu6oJ8vu8gGms8vKBWBK1No